Exploring the little-known camaraderie between Senna and Schumacher

Jonathan Wheatley was in his fourth season of Method 1 as a mechanic in 1994, having began on Roberto Moreno’s automotive at Benetton earlier than the Brazilian was ousted in favour of Michael Schumacher.

That gave him a ringside seat for the early levels of what was shaping as much as be one in all motor racing’s nice rivalries – till tragedy struck at Imola in the course of the San Marino Grand Prix weekend 31 years in the past.

These not round in F1 on the time are inclined to view this period as one in all cut-throat competitors, epitomised by political and technical skulduggery. The Benetton workforce spent a lot of that 12 months beneath suspicion of breaking the principles.

On the observe, the battles between Schumacher and Ayrton Senna – younger charger versus established nice – usually cleaved to this narrative of bitter rancour. Every would eagerly complain in regards to the different’s on-track conduct whereas preventing for positions.

However Wheatley, now workforce principal at Sauber, remembers a completely totally different ambiance prevailing behind the scenes.

“We had this type of ongoing relationship in 1994,” he advised F1’s Past the Grid podcast, “the place Michael would set a pole place, after which when Ayrton would come out of the storage [into the pitlane], I might present him the pitboard with Michael’s time on it.

“And he’d like open his visor, shake his head, shut it. He’d are available in, go quicker than Michael, and he’d be me [on] the pitwall as if to say, ‘Nicely, the place’s my time [on the pitboard]?’

“There was this camaraderie that possibly folks aren’t conscious of. You are not simply in fierce competitors with folks. You are rubbing up in opposition to them.”

The occasions of the San Marino Grand Prix weekend introduced that hidden sense of togetherness out into the open: forward of Senna’s deadly accident within the race on 1 Could, Rubens Barrichello had escaped a heavy shunt into the obstacles throughout Friday observe and Roland Ratzenberger had been killed when the entrance wing of his Simtek got here adrift at pace on Saturday.

F1 then was very totally different to how it’s as we speak for paddock personnel; there have been no curfews to restrict working hours and, for younger mechanics, a work-hard-play-hard ethic prevailed. The occasions of Imola delivered a brutal reminder of the dangers inherent in top-level motor racing.

“Imola 1994 is the worst weekend I can ever bear in mind,” stated Wheatley. “I can nonetheless bear in mind the feelings.

“I’ve stored a variety of stuff from ’94 as a result of I believe, for me as a younger man, that was a serious turning level. I can nonetheless bear in mind Mick Cowlishaw, the [Benetton] chief mechanic, coming as much as me and placing his hand on my arm, as a result of he knew the connection I had and the way I considered it, and telling me he [Senna] had gone.

“That weekend was stuffed with so many issues. You recognize, Rubens’ crash, the place he places his palms in entrance of his face [at the moment of impact with the barrier]. That picture is unbelievable. It simply reveals the human being contained in the automotive.

“Then Roland. I can bear in mind seeing that on TV and instantly understanding this was not a standard accident – this was actually, actually critical. Then within the race, JJ [Lehto] stalling on the grid; the huge impression that precipitated the purple flag.

“Then [Michele] Alboreto misplaced his wheel within the pitlane and the wheel nut hit my primary mechanic; it minimize his leg. The wheel went into the Lotus pit the place it hit anyone in there… then Senna’s accident within the race.

“We did not need to get on the aircraft. I can bear in mind we have been sat across the airport lounge in silence. The Williams guys had simply been advised about Ayrton, and none of us needed to get on the aircraft – ‘What is the subsequent factor that is going to occur?’”
